About mins from St Tropez a low key little restaurant. The whole crab was extremely fresh and the Vietnamese spring rolls delicious. The grilled sea bass was very tasty. The only downfall was the pan fried squid which was too chewy. Reasonable prices and...generous portions.

This place has a good reputation, and although I am a local in the area, haven't been in years. Had Sunday lunch here today, ordered the seafood/fish platter. Good food, presented well. Good, friendly service as you would expect in a good French brasserie. The...place doesn't have enormous charm or atmosphere except that people that come here seem happy and content which in itself is a big plus. Good honest food (at the usual inflated St. Tropez-ish prices, but what can you do...
